Two JBLM soldiers arrested in connection with homicide in Kittitas County

PIERCE COUNTY, Wash. — Two active-duty Joint Base Lewis McChord soldiers were arrested Thursday in connection with a homicide in Kittitas County, deputies said.

The body of 20-year-old Leroy Scott was found April 25 along Smithson Road, north of Ellensburg, investigators said.

Investigators said Scott was at a party with 20-year-old Raylin James and 20-year-old Joshua Gerald the night of the murder.

Both men were arrested without incident, authorities said.

The investigation remains ongoing.
